My 2002 Jetta TDI seems to be having a tough time starting on cold mornings. I saw one suggestion that it might be fuel filters, but this car had been meticulously maintained - as the prior owner had a complete maintenance plan. Would the glow plugs have anything to do with it? I saw a similar entry in her maintenance log book. Once warm, it runs fine and can start often - and easily.

Yes glow plugs have a lot to do with engine having tough
time in cold weather. before replacing glow plugs
check relay and fuses.

Wondering what rpm should a 2002 jetta tdi be idling at?right now it seems at 850 to 900 which seems a bit high. i would figure it to be normal at 550 to 650 , any help is appreciated.

when cold it will idle a tad higher 850 - 900 is normal cold , and around 600 warm. if it is idleing high after warm up then check for excessive coke<carbon> build up in intake and throttle valve.
